facebooktwitterpinterest
Utah Bat N Wildlife Specialists
768 Bradford Dr , North Salt Lake 84054, UT, US
(801) 675-8829
  • (21)
Extermiman
882 Foxboro Dr , North Salt Lake 84054, UT, US
(801) 296-5960
  • (21)
preview photo
North Salt Lake Pest Control Map, Satellite View of List